I spent days and days creating the game!
I spent every morning for weeks recording the shows onto my PC so that I could screenshot and sample things. Then there was the bitmap editing and sound editing- both very demanding tasks but the end result was great, then there was the interpreting of the rooms onto the 2D view, then finally the programming and links!!!!
I had to debate about the angle to make it convincing- one option was to make it a vertical view down onto the dungeoneer but in the end, I decided to work on a vew slightly higher than on the programme.
After each room was created, I would then test the game for everything- boundaries, doorways, energy-damages, etc...
So basically, It took me a lot longer than you think!!!
